1. What is a thread rolling head used for?
Thread rolling heads are used to create high-precision, durable threads on metal components, improving their strength and performance in various applications.
2. How does thread rolling compare to cutting threads?
Thread rolling produces stronger, more durable threads with fewer defects compared to cutting methods, which generate more waste and can result in weaker threads.

6. How does thread rolling improve the strength of threads?
Thread rolling compresses the material, which enhances the tensile strength of the threads, making them more resistant to stress and wear.
7. What materials are commonly used with thread rolling heads?
Thread rolling heads are used with various metals, including steel, aluminum, and titanium, to produce strong, durable threads for different applications.
